Transaction ddb6c20ee5398b07cc70a7f2f645a0ab6443921494bb39aa48d67d26ce0271d2
1 Input
1 Output
-
ddb6c20ee5398b07cc70a7f2f645a0ab6443921494bb39aa48d67d26ce0271d2:0
- value
- 18910521
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 831aae29a3f14d6a353ff198099d59d2c62371f5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CxDUur11poD6h46k8bu89TVJvFSJQnPwg